Hingstons of Wilton has dated this piece to the 19th Century.
This Antique oak and elm dresser base is of an unusual size, having 2 drawers of a good depth.
This small dresser base stands on turned legs that finish on pad feet to each corner. It is of a very good size and so will fit in many places around the home.

The top boards are made of solid oak, while the drawers and carcass are made of elm.

This dresser base really is attractive to the eye, as it is of a lovely honey colour, as well as being of a great small size.
